码迷,mamicode.com
首页 > Web开发 > 详细

php类似shell脚本的用法

时间:2017-08-28 20:00:53      阅读:230      评论:0      收藏:0      [点我收藏+]

标签:order   另一个   属性   计算机   运行   用法   shell   一个   body   

参考: http://www.cnblogs.com/myjavawork/articles/1869205.html

 

 

php还可以用于类似于shell脚本,哈哈,对编程语言对整个计算机系统的认识又多了一个角度

技术分享

 

----------------------------------------------------------------------

除此之外,我们还有另一个方法将 PHP 用于外壳脚本。您可以在写一个脚本,并在第一行以 #!/usr/bin/php 开头,在其后加上以 PHP 开始和结尾标记符包含的正常的 PHP 代码,然后为该文件设置正确的运行属性。该方法可以使得该文件能够像外壳脚本或 PERL 脚本一样被直接执行。

#!/usr/bin/php
<?php
    var_dump($argv);
?>

假设改文件名为 test 并被放置在当前目录下,我们可以做如下操作:

$ chmod 755 test
$ ./test -h -- foo
array(4) {
  [0]=>
  string(6) "./test"
  [1]=>
  string(2) "-h"
  [2]=>
  string(2) "--"
  [3]=>
  string(3) "foo"
}

正如您所看到的,在您向该脚本传送以 - 开头的参数时,脚本仍然能够正常运行。

php类似shell脚本的用法

标签:order   另一个   属性   计算机   运行   用法   shell   一个   body   

原文地址:http://www.cnblogs.com/oxspirt/p/7442353.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!